Understanding Fear

1. What is fear?

Fear is an emotional response to a perceived threat or danger. It activates our body’s fight-or-flight response, preparing us to either confront the threat or run away from it.

2. Why do we experience fear?

Fear is a natural survival mechanism that helps us stay safe. It alerts us to potential dangers in our environment and allows us to take appropriate action to protect ourselves.

Common Fears and Phobias

1. What are common fears?

  • Fear of heights
  • Fear of public speaking
  • Fear of spiders or insects
  • Fear of failure
  • Fear of rejection

2. What are phobias?

Phobias are intense, irrational fears of specific objects, situations, or activities. They can significantly impact a person’s quality of life and may require professional help to overcome.

3. How do fears and phobias affect us?

Fears and phobias can limit our daily activities, hinder personal growth, and negatively impact our mental well-being. They can also lead to avoidance behaviors and social isolation.

Overcoming Fears:

1. Can fears be overcome?

Yes, fears can be managed and overcome with the right strategies and support.

2. What are some techniques to overcome fears?

  • Gradual exposure therapy: Facing fears gradually and in manageable steps.
  • Cognitive-behavioral therapy: Identifying and challenging irrational thoughts and beliefs related to fears.
  • Mindfulness and relaxation techniques: Helping to reduce anxiety and promote a sense of calm.
  • Seeking professional help: Consulting a therapist or psychologist who specializes in anxiety disorders.

Embracing Courage and Growth

1. How can facing fears lead to personal growth?

By confronting our fears, we develop resilience, gain confidence, and expand our comfort zones. This can lead to personal growth, improved self-esteem, and a greater sense of empowerment.

2. Are fears ever beneficial?

While fears can be challenging, they also serve to protect us. It’s important to differentiate between rational fears and irrational fears or phobias that hinder our daily lives.
